Transmission Line Project Manager – ENTRUST Solutions Group
Join ENTRUST Solutions Group as a Transmission Line Project Manager and become a vital part of our dynamic team! In this role you will lead and execute complex engineering projects related to transmission lines, ensuring they meet client and internal performance indicators. Your focus will be on maintaining schedule and budget performance, enhancing project profitability, and fostering strong client relationships and satisfaction. Quality control will also be a key aspect of your responsibilities.
You will supervise and mentor other team members, including Project Engineers and Designers, working closely with peers, senior technical leads, and engineers to achieve project goals. You will also be responsible for maintaining accurate fee revenue forecasts and ensuring our engineering practices align with industry standards, regulatory requirements, and technical innovations.
In addition, you will play an active role in sales calls and client presentations, showcasing our expertise and commitment to excellence. If you are passionate about engineering and looking for a role where you can make a significant impact, we encourage you to apply and join our inclusive and supportive team at ENTRUST Solutions Group.
Key Responsibilities
Plan, organize, supervise and otherwise manage the engineering and design of transmission line facilities.
Lead and manage the execution of transmission line projects ranging from 69kV to 500kV.
Develop project proposals, estimates, and execution plans.
Collaborate with clients and stakeholders to deliver innovative project solutions.
Manage project schedules, budgets, and resources to ensure projects are completed on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ards.
Provide technical guidance and mentorship to engineering and design teams.
Maintain strong relationships with clients, stakeholders, and team members.
Define performance expectations and review and reward job performance to align individual performance with business goals.
Develop employee skills to reach their potential and establish career development plans.
Travel as necessary for client meetings and site visits.
Required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in civil engineering or a related field from an accredited university.
Professional Engineering license is preferred.
PMP certification is a plus.
Minimum of 5 years of transmission line work experience.
Proficiency in PLS software.
Strong leadership and team management skills.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
Ability to lead projects by collaborating with cross‑functional teams.
